Fan are happy and excited with the announcement earlier this year that their favorite show, Sleepy Hollow, has been renewed for a third season. While details of what will be of the third season has still not been disclosed, Tom Mison shares his thoughts on what he wishes to happen. When Sleepy Hollow Season 3 returns, the show may be indulging fans to a motorcycle-riding Ichabod Crane and Abbie Mills, if lead star Tom Mison were to have it his way.

Tom Mison was asked about what he was eager to look forward to in the upcoming season of the show and he openly shared his thoughts and wishes. “I would like to see the Ichabbie-mobile. Maybe Abbie riding the motorbike and Ichabod riding the side car, that’s how they get around,” said the much loved Sleepy Hollow actor.

The actor also referred to what he deemed was a highlight of the last season, his meeting Bejamin Franklin, that made him think of an episode. “I hope… we’ll see much more of him… I’d like to see an 18th century heist with Ichabod, Jefferson, and Franklin. Mainly because I’d like to see Steven Weber (Thomas Jefferson) and Tim Busfield (Ben Franklin) bickering while picking a safe. That’s my dream,” articulated Tom Mison who plays Ichabod Crane.

These fancies are yet be granted by new show runner Clifton Campbell who was hired by Fox to provide the history-twisting time-travelling show another 18 episodes in the upcoming third season. New show runner, Campbell has produced White Collar, another series known for its story twists that spin around an FBI fugitive who manifests into a source, and The Glades, where a lethargic town turns up dead bodies to the shock of a homicide detective who moved there to run away from his accustomed crime scenes.

Campbell is supposed to keep hold of Sleepy Hollow’s serialized rudiments such as the story of the Headless Horseman and the fight in opposition to evil, even though it has been reported that the next Sleepy Hollow will have less of the serialized plots and more of standalone episodic plots as Fox hopes to revert to its lost footing from the triumphant fast-paced, tightly-woven story of the genre series that was Season 1.

TV Line has also discovered that Sleepy Hollow will be moving the filming location of the show to Atlanta as a replacement for of the season 1 and 2 set in Wilmington, North Carolina.

Sleepy Hollow was co-created by Alex Kurtzman, Roberto Orci, Phillip Iscove and Len Wiseman.

For quite a while there was discussion that Sleepy Hollow would not get renewed mainly because of what Variety reports as the dismal slide in ratings from the 11.1  million viewers it had when it debuted in season 1, going down to 7.1 million in the second season. Hopefully the third season will pick up on its numbers.

Fans will have to wait quite a while for more of Ichabod Crane and Abbie Mills. Sleepy Hollow Season 3 will debut in the fall on Fox television.
